Overview
The BAT54WS-7-F is a surface mount Schottky barrier diode manufactured by Diodes Incorporated. This component is designed for high-speed switching applications and is known for its ultra-small SOD323 package. It features a PN junction guard ring for transient and ESD protection, making it highly reliable in various electronic systems. The BAT54WS-7-F is fully RoHS compliant, halogen and antimony free, and qualified to AEC-Q101 standards, ensuring its suitability for automotive and other demanding applications.
Key Specifications
Characteristic | Symbol | Min | Typ | Max | Unit | Test Condition |
---|---|---|---|---|---|---|
Reverse Breakdown Voltage | V(BR)R | 30 | V | IR = 100µA | ||
Forward Voltage | VFM | 240, 320, 400, 500, 1000 | mV | IF = 0.1mA, 1mA, 10mA, 30mA, 100mA | ||
Reverse Leakage Current | IRM | 2.0 | µA | VR = 25V | ||
Total Capacitance | CT | 10 | pF | VR = 1.0V, f = 1.0MHz | ||
Reverse Recovery Time | tRR | 5.0 | ns | IF = 10mA through IR = 10mA to IR = 1.0mA, RL = 100Ω | ||
Power Dissipation | PD | 200 | mW | |||
Thermal Resistance, Junction to Ambient Air | RθJA | 625 | °C/W | |||
Operating and Storage Temperature Range | TJ, TSTG | -65 | +150 | °C | ||
Package | SOD323 | |||||
Moisture Sensitivity | Level 1 per J-STD-020 |
Key Features
- Fast Switching: The BAT54WS-7-F is designed for ultra-high-speed switching applications.
- Ultra-Small Surface Mount Package: It comes in the compact SOD323 package, making it ideal for space-constrained designs.
- PN Junction Guard Ring for Transient and ESD Protection: Provides enhanced protection against transient and electrostatic discharge (ESD) events.
- Totally Lead-Free & Fully RoHS Compliant: Meets EU Directive 2002/95/EC (RoHS), 2011/65/EU (RoHS 2), and 2015/863/EU (RoHS 3) compliance standards.
- Halogen and Antimony Free: Classified as a “Green” device, containing less than 900ppm bromine, chlorine, and antimony compounds.
- AEC-Q101 Qualified: Suitable for automotive applications, PPAP capable, and manufactured in IATF 16949 certified facilities.
Applications
The BAT54WS-7-F is versatile and can be used in a variety of applications, including:
- Consumer Electronics: Suitable for low voltage, low power applications such as voltage regulation and rectification.
- Sensors and Industrial Controls: Its high-speed switching and low forward voltage drop make it ideal for sensor and industrial control systems.
- Automotive Systems: Qualified to AEC-Q101 standards, it is reliable for use in automotive electronics.
- Reverse Polarity Protection and Freewheeling: Can be used for reverse polarity protection and freewheeling diode applications due to its fast switching capabilities.
